There were four tigers, part of 13th Company. They were not near the battle west of Prokhorovka. Instead, they were destroying, single-handedly, and entire tank brigade to the North, near 3rd SS Panzergrenadier (Totenkopf). The were not at the area typically located in the big close-in fight. The Tigers prevailed against the Soviets at stand-off ranges.
